ENGLISH SECOND LANGUAGE PROGRAM
Marshall Public Schools has Kindergarten
through Twelfth grade English Second Language programming (ESL) for our
students whose second language is English. There are licensed English
Limited Language teachers in each building.
Students are evaluated in the Fall and
Spring for eligibility and progress/exiting purposes. The core
curriculum implemented is Hampton Brown Literacy for ELL students.
ELL students are also eligible for Title
I services for supplemental reading support and special education for
learning disabilities. Evaluation also determines eligibility for
those programs.
All students in Marshall Public Schools
take the Minnesota Comprehensive Assessments II. ELL students are
also required by the Minnesota Department of Education to take the Test
of Emerging Academic English which evaluates reading, writing, listening
and speaking for proficiency purposes.
